Introduction to Construction/Civil Engineering in Penistone

Penistone, a charming market town nestled in South Yorkshire, England, is not only known for its picturesque landscapes but also for its burgeoning construction and civil engineering sector. This industry plays a pivotal role in shaping the town's infrastructure, enhancing its connectivity, and supporting its economic growth. In this article, we delve into the multifaceted world of construction and civil engineering in Penistone, exploring its significance, challenges, and future prospects.

The Historical Evolution of Construction in Penistone

The history of construction in Penistone is as rich as the town itself. From its early days, when local craftsmen built stone cottages and barns, to the modern era of sophisticated infrastructure projects, Penistone has witnessed a remarkable transformation. The construction industry here has evolved from traditional methods to incorporate advanced technologies and sustainable practices, reflecting broader trends in the UK.

Traditional Building Techniques

In the past, construction in Penistone relied heavily on locally sourced materials like stone and timber. These materials were not only abundant but also suited the local climate. Traditional techniques, such as dry stone walling and timber framing, were prevalent, and many of these structures still stand today, testament to their durability and craftsmanship.

Modern Advancements

With the advent of industrialisation, construction in Penistone began to embrace modern materials and techniques. The introduction of steel and concrete revolutionised building practices, allowing for more ambitious projects. Today, the industry is characterised by the use of cutting-edge technology, including computer-aided design (CAD) and building information modelling (BIM), which enhance precision and efficiency.

Key Players in Penistone's Construction Industry

The construction landscape in Penistone is shaped by a diverse array of stakeholders, from local builders to large engineering firms. These players collaborate to deliver projects that meet the town's growing needs while adhering to stringent safety and environmental standards.

Local Construction Companies

Local construction companies are the backbone of Penistone's industry. These firms, often family-run, bring a wealth of experience and a deep understanding of the local context. They are instrumental in executing residential, commercial, and public projects, contributing significantly to the town's development.

Engineering Consultancies

Engineering consultancies play a crucial role in the planning and execution of complex projects. These firms provide expertise in structural engineering, environmental impact assessments, and project management, ensuring that projects are completed on time and within budget.

Infrastructure Development in Penistone

Infrastructure development is a cornerstone of Penistone's construction sector. The town's strategic location necessitates robust transport networks, efficient utilities, and modern public facilities to support its residents and businesses.

Transport Infrastructure

Penistone's transport infrastructure has seen significant improvements over the years. The town is well-connected by road and rail, facilitating easy access to nearby cities like Sheffield and Barnsley. Recent projects have focused on upgrading roads, enhancing public transport services, and improving pedestrian and cycling routes.

Utilities and Public Services

Ensuring reliable utilities and public services is essential for Penistone's growth. Construction projects in this domain include the development of water supply systems, waste management facilities, and energy-efficient public buildings. These initiatives aim to enhance the quality of life for residents while promoting sustainability.

Sustainability in Penistone's Construction Practices

Sustainability is a key consideration in Penistone's construction industry. As environmental concerns take centre stage globally, local builders and engineers are adopting eco-friendly practices to minimise their impact on the environment.

Green Building Techniques

Green building techniques are gaining traction in Penistone. These practices involve using sustainable materials, improving energy efficiency, and reducing waste. Projects often incorporate features like solar panels, rainwater harvesting systems, and green roofs to enhance environmental performance.

Regulatory Framework

The regulatory framework governing construction in Penistone supports sustainability. Local authorities enforce building codes and standards that promote eco-friendly practices, ensuring that new developments align with broader environmental goals.

Challenges Facing the Construction Industry in Penistone

Despite its successes, the construction industry in Penistone faces several challenges. These include economic fluctuations, skill shortages, and regulatory hurdles, all of which can impact project delivery and industry growth.

Economic Uncertainty

Economic uncertainty, driven by factors such as Brexit and global market fluctuations, poses a significant challenge. These uncertainties can affect investment levels, project financing, and the availability of materials, leading to delays and cost overruns.

Skill Shortages

The industry also grapples with skill shortages, particularly in specialised areas like engineering and project management. Addressing this issue requires investment in training and education to equip the workforce with the necessary skills.

Future Prospects for Construction in Penistone

Looking ahead, the future of construction in Penistone appears promising. With ongoing investments in infrastructure and a focus on sustainability, the industry is well-positioned to support the town's growth and development.

Technological Innovations

Technological innovations are set to play a pivotal role in the industry's future. Emerging technologies like drones, 3D printing, and artificial intelligence offer new possibilities for project delivery, enhancing efficiency and reducing costs.

Community Engagement

Community engagement is increasingly important in construction projects. By involving local residents and stakeholders in the planning process, developers can ensure that projects meet community needs and gain public support.
